Rolex

 

There are many different types of Rolexes to choose from depending on your needs, including dress watches that can go with any outfit or occasion, sport watches for going out on adventures, and divers watches for those who like to explore underwater. I have a few of my own favorite watches for men brands that I think are worth mentioning, so let's start with the Rolex Oyster Perpetual Day-Date watch.

 

It has a day/date function as well as a smooth sweeping second hand which makes it perfect for business meetings and dates alike. It comes in various colors such as silver, gold, black, etc., so you're sure to find the one you want. Next up is the Rolex Oyster Perpetual Submariner watch which is perfect if you love diving deep into the ocean because it was designed to be waterproof down to 300 meters below sea level!

 

Longines

 

Longines is one of the most famous watches for men brands. They have been making watches since 1832, and their quality never ceases to amaze. Longines are considered a status symbol that many people strive to have. Longines has over 100 years of experience in watchmaking and holds 6 time-keeping records, so you can be sure that they will last a lifetime.

 

If you are looking for watches for men's brands, look no further than this trusted company! The first thing that makes these watches stand out is their design; it's classic yet modern at the same time. These sleek designs are perfect if you want something classic but with a little flair! Longines has made these designs as timeless as possible with an elegant black dial with silver or gold hands and hour markers. These subtle details show just how much thought went into each design.

 

Another reason why Longines stands out from other watches for men brands is because of its movement; quartz, automatic or mechanical movements are all available at different price points making it easy to find the right fit for your needs!

 

Maurice Lacroix

 

One of the great things about a Maurice Lacroix watch is that it can be worn casually or more formally depending on the occasion. Some timepieces even have movable bezels so you can change the color scheme from day to night with ease. They also offer a variety of materials to choose from including titanium, leather, stainless steel, and many others. A few other brands offer similar selections but not all at this level of quality.
